Art Deco Walnut Bed

An art deco walnut bed brings the bold lines and symmetrical geometry of the interwar period directly into a bedroom. Pieces range from straightforward double bed frames to elaborate designs featuring integral bedside tables, headboards, and over-bed reading stands.

Most examples date from the nineteen thirties, though earlier nineteen twenties frames and occasional nineteenth century French empire styles appear. Buyers encounter single beds, double beds, king size bedsteads, and separate headboards.

Cabinetmakers constructed these frames to anchor the bedroom suite, often matching them with bedside cabinets and chests. The aesthetic relies heavily on clean horizontal and vertical sweeps, stepped cornices, and fan shapes.

How they were made

Materials and construction

Carpeneters utilised walnut, burr walnut, and figured walnut veneers laid over a timber core to create striking symmetrical grain patterns on headboards and footboards. Satinwood and steel or iron details frequently provide contrasting accents against the dark timber.

French polish and similar clear finishes highlight the natural figure of the wood, while chrome fittings appear on reading stands and specific modernist frames.

What sets them apart

What separates the best pieces

Quality rests in the choice and matching of timber veneers across the face of the headboard. Highly figured burr walnut and book-matched grain patterns demonstrate superior craftsmanship compared to plain timber surfaces.

The integration of matching furniture, such as attached bedside cabinets and nightstands, distinguishes comprehensive suites from standard single frames.

Terms antiques dealers use

The Art Deco Walnut Bed Glossary

Burr walnut
A specialised timber cut from the abnormal growth of a walnut tree, yielding swirling, knotty grain patterns. This material was highly prized for decorative veneer work on prominent furniture faces.
Veneer
A thin slice of superior wood glued over a secondary timber base. This technique allowed makers to display dramatic grain figures across large surfaces without using solid luxury wood.
Bedstead
A framework of a bed supporting the spring and mattress. These freestanding structures often feature decorative footboards and headboards.
Satinwood
A durable, yellowish timber utilised for contrasting inlay and banding. Makers paired it with darker walnut to create bright highlights on bed frames.
Headboard
The upright panel attached to the head of a bed. In this period, they frequently incorporate curved geometries and built-in nightstands.
Questions people ask

Art Deco Walnut Bed: Frequently Asked Questions

What sizes do these beds come in?

Frames appear in standard single, double, and king size formats alongside custom headboard widths. Paired single beds also exist for twin room layouts.

Buyers should measure mattress clearances carefully, as older French and English dimensions can differ slightly from modern standards.

How do I care for walnut veneer?

Protect the polished surfaces from direct sunlight and excessive moisture to prevent fading and veneer lifting. Regular dusting with a soft, dry cloth maintains the natural sheen.

Avoid silicone-based polishes which can build up and dull the historic finish over time.

Did these beds come with matching furniture?

Many frames formed part of larger bedroom suites that included matching bedside cabinets, chests of drawers, and dressing tables. Some designs incorporate bedside tables directly into the headboard structure.

Finding a complete suite with intact nightstands is a notable feature for collectors.

How do I identify a nineteen thirties piece?

Look for characteristic geometric motifs, stepped headboards, and fan shapes executed in figured walnut veneers. The construction techniques and timber choices align with interwar design standards.

Earlier pieces from the nineteen twenties often display simpler structural lines before the curved styles of the thirties emerged.
